Type your search query and hit enter:
Re-entry to Canada
Uncategorized
What is Authorization to Return to Canada (ARC)?
3 months ago
Immigration Blog
Been Removed from Canada? Here’s What You Need to Know About ARC
5 months ago
This website uses cookies.
Accept